Web2 apr. 2024 · In this vein, the United States has developed three theater (regional) systems and one to protect the homeland, the Ground-Based Midcourse Defense (GMD) system. Theater Ballistic Missile Defense systems target incoming short-, medium- and intermediate-range ballistic missiles. Web2 mrt. 2024 · The long-range S-300 system began development in the 1960s and entered service in the Soviet Union in 1978. There are several variants. The S-300 launcher is usually mounted on a heavy MAZ-7910 truck. Later variants of the S-300 have a range of up to 93 miles. The 9K35 Strela-10 is a highly mobile, visually aimed, optical/infrared-guided, low-altitude, short-range surface-to-air missile system. The Strela-10 system was originally designed to use the 9M37 missile as its primary weapon. Each 9M37 missile is 2.2 m long, weighs 40 kg and carries a 3.5 kg warhead.
